-while supporting Solana's network security. This dual benefit of yield generation and ecosystem participation is a key driver for institutional adoption.Solana's institutional appeal is further reinforced by its growing presence in corporate treasuries.
, corporations collectively hold approximately 5.9 million SOL, or 1% of the circulating supply. This includes major players like Forward Industries (6.82 million SOL), DeFi Development Corp. (2.095 million SOL), and Upexi Inc. (2.018 million SOL). These holdings are not static; companies are actively staking their assets to capitalize on high returns. Solana's staking yields significantly outperform traditional alternatives. For context, Bitcoin's staking equivalent (via lending or derivatives) typically yields less than 2–3%, and U.S. Treasury bonds hover near 4–5%. Solana's 6–8% range offers a compelling middle ground between risk and reward, particularly in a macroeconomic environment where inflation and interest rates remain elevated.

While the case for Solana is strong, challenges remain. Regulatory uncertainty in key markets, liquidity risks for large holdings, and the inherent volatility of crypto markets are legitimate concerns. However, the growing number of corporations treating Solana as a core treasury asset-rather than a speculative overlay-suggests that these risks are being actively managed through diversification, staking, and institutional-grade custodianship.
